+/**
+ * read_seqbegin_or_lock - begin a sequence number check or locking block
+ * lock: sequence lock
+ * seq : sequence number to be checked
+ *
+ * First try it once optimistically without taking the lock. If that fails,
+ * take the lock. The sequence number is also used as a marker for deciding
+ * whether to be a reader (even) or writer (odd).
+ * N.B. seq must be initialized to an even number to begin with.
+ */
+static inline void read_seqbegin_or_lock(seqlock_t *lock, int *seq)
+{
+ if (!(*seq & 1)) /* Even */
+ *seq = read_seqbegin(lock);
+ else /* Odd */
+ write_seqlock(lock);
+}
+
+static inline int need_seqretry(seqlock_t *lock, int seq)
+{
+ return !(seq & 1) && read_seqretry(lock, seq);
+}
+
+static inline void done_seqretry(seqlock_t *lock, int seq)
+{
+ if (seq & 1)
+ write_sequnlock(lock);
+}
+

+/**
+ * prepend_name - prepend a pathname in front of current buffer pointer
+ * buffer: buffer pointer
+ * buflen: allocated length of the buffer
+ * name: name string and length qstr structure
+ *
+ * With RCU path tracing, it may race with d_move(). Use ACCESS_ONCE() to
+ * make sure that either the old or the new name pointer and length are
+ * fetched. However, there may be mismatch between length and pointer.
+ * The length cannot be trusted, we need to copy it byte-by-byte until
+ * the length is reached or a null byte is found. It also prepends "/" at
+ * the beginning of the name. The sequence number check at the caller will
+ * retry it again when a d_move() does happen. So any garbage in the buffer
+ * due to mismatched pointer and length will be discarded.
+ */
static int prepend_name(char **buffer, int *buflen, struct qstr *name)
{
- return prepend(buffer, buflen, name->name, name->len);
+ const char *dname = ACCESS_ONCE(name->name);
+ u32 dlen = ACCESS_ONCE(name->len);
+ char *p;
+
+ if (*buflen < dlen + 1)
+ return -ENAMETOOLONG;
+ *buflen -= dlen + 1;
+ p = *buffer -= dlen + 1;
+ *p++ = '/';
+ while (dlen--) {
+ char c = *dname++;
+ if (!c)
+ break;
+ *p++ = c;
+ }
+ return 0;
}
